GoPro Hero 7 Leaked Via In-Store Display

Sep. 3, 2018



GoPro may be down, but it’s certainly not out of the game just yet. The San Mateo, California-based company is reportedly planning to launch an all-new action camera called the Hero 7 later this month, and the device is now believed to have been leaked in the form of an in-store display.Image Courtesy: AustinMittelstadt

Originallyposted on Reddit(via Imgur), the images have since apparently been removed, but not before being savedby The Verge. The photographs reveal very little info about what to expect from the upcoming device, but does seem to suggest that it will be launched in three different colors – white, silver and black – and will be waterproof up to a depth of about 10 meters (33 feet).Image Courtesy: AustinMittelstadt

It’s worth noting here that like some of theprevious-generation models, the Hero 7 will also seemingly come in a number of different options if the images are anything to go by. As can be seen, the black version will apparently ship with a front-facing display while the other two will seemingly skip the feature. It’s not immediately clear, though, if there will be more differences between the three models.Image Courtesy: AustinMittelstadt
